When searching for information about International Women’s Day (IWD) 2018, I knew I would not find details from the U.S. government. It doesn’t coordinate IWD events or recognize it as an official holiday, unlike 26 nations that include Afghanistan, Cuba, Laos, Russia and Uganda. About Aimee Loiselle
Aimee Loiselle is a writer, scholar, educator and speaker interested in work and the distribution of income and wealth. She focuses on working women, gender and race with attention to global capitalism, labor and the influence of popular culture. As a nontraditional Ph.D. student in history, Loiselle brings both her intersectional research and experiences as a working woman together for public outreach.
